Transaction 1191270086e8fc99782948ceef0d7d32079cedce3ac3a1275541221553736ae2

3 Input
2 Outputs
  • 1191270086e8fc99782948ceef0d7d32079cedce3ac3a1275541221553736ae2:0
  • value  1368091260
    address  37uM83U4tXfm5oz18o7LBJeT2PBKbLbtKk
  • 1191270086e8fc99782948ceef0d7d32079cedce3ac3a1275541221553736ae2:1
  • value  27197520
    address  3FDZiLDhhLBGAujPVU8hgdwv2dXuzbUmio